I've just set a custom fan curve for my 5850, But I was wondering does it need to be open for this to be applied? For example if I restart without it opening, Will it just revert back to stock fan speeds?

If thats the case, Is it 'safe' to flash the 5850's with Atiflash/RBE? Or is that a no go with these cards? Ive been out of the loop for a while.
 
I think it has to be open for the fan profile to work.

Someone's sure to come along and correct me if I'm wrong.
 
I set it to open at start-up but run from the system tray. I think it configures itself to do this by default if you say 'apply profile at start-up'. If not, there are a few checkboxes in the settings somewhere.
